Ribble Valley honours outstanding businesses

By Tim Aldred

11 Oct 2019

rbva-2019-beacon.jpg

Ribble Valley businesses have been honoured at a prize-giving ceremony which took place at Cltheroe's Stirk House.

Of the 159 businesses and individuals who were nominated, around 50 were listed as finalists, and the winners of 18 categories were revealed in front of an audience of 280.

Those who took home trophies included Whitewell’s Inch Perfect Trials (pictured) which won both the apprentice award and the Beacon award as the 'most inspirational'.

Sarwat Jaleel, owner of KUSHBOO SOAPS in Clitheroe, manufactures vegan and sustainable soaps, and donates one to a food bank, homeless person or women’s refuge for each one sold. Her business was a finalist in four categories, and won the Made in Ribble Valley award.

Stella Brunskill, Mayor of Ribble Valley, said:"I think it is fantastic, all these people have gone the extra mile. Setting up and running your own business is going the extra mile. You can feel the enthusiasm in the room.”
